show someone a good time

idiom
Meaning

To sleep with; have sex with.


Examples
SIMPLE

He really wants to show her a good time tonight.

CONTEXTUAL

After their third date, he invited her back to his apartment, hoping to show her a good time.

COMPLEX

The protagonist found himself caught in a web of deceit after promising to show the visitor a good time, unaware of the dangerous consequences that would follow.
